Because as many as half of glaucoma patients on intraocular pressure (IOP)-lowering therapy continue to experience optic nerve toxicity, it is imperative to find other effective therapies. Iron and calcium ions play key roles in oxidative stress, a hallmark of glaucoma. Therefore, we tested metal chelation by means of ethylenediaminetetraacetic acid (EDTA) combined with the permeability enhancer methylsulfonylmethane (MSM) applied topically on the eye to determine if this noninvasive treatment is neuroprotective in rat optic nerve and retinal ganglion cells exposed to oxidative stress induced by elevated IOP. Hyaluronic acid (HA) was injected into the anterior chamber of the rat eye to elevate the IOP. EDTA-MSM was applied topically to the eye for 3 months. Eyeballs and optic nerves were processed for histological assessment of cytoarchitecture. Protein-lipid aldehyde adducts and cyclooxygenase-2 (COX-2) were detected immunohistochemically. HA administration increased IOP and associated oxidative stress and inflammation. Elevated IOP was not affected by EDTA-MSM treatment. However, oxidative damage and inflammation were ameliorated as reflected by a decrease in formation of protein-lipid aldehyde adducts and COX-2 expression, respectively. Furthermore, EDTA-MSM treatment increased retinal ganglion cell survival and decreased demyelination of optic nerve compared with untreated eyes. Chelation treatment with EDTA-MSM ameliorates sequelae of IOP-induced toxicity without affecting IOP. Because most current therapies aim at reducing IOP and damage occurs even in the absence of elevated IOP, EDTA-MSM has the potential to work in conjunction with pressure-reducing therapies to alleviate damage to the optic nerve and retinal ganglion cells.

Oxidative stress leading to lipid peroxidation is a problem in neurodegenerative diseases, because the brain is rich in polyunsaturated fatty acids and low in endogenous antioxidants. One of the most toxic byproducts of lipid peroxidation, 4-hydroxynonenal (HNE), is implicated in oxidative stress-induced damage in neurodegenerative diseases such as Alzheimer's disease (AD), Parkinson's disease (PD), and amyotrophic lateral sclerosis (ALS). In this study, the human neuroblastoma cell line SH-SY5Y was used to test the protective effects of increasing the detoxification of HNE by overexpressing the HNE-detoxifying enzyme aldehyde dehydrogenase 1A1 (ALDH1). Overexpression of ALDH1 in the SH-SY5Y cells acts to reduce production of protein-HNE adducts and activation of caspase-3. Our data suggest that detoxification of HNE could be therapeutic in preventing some of the toxic disruptions of the brain's redox systems found in many neurodegenerative diseases.

'Ready-for-use' instruments from surgical instrument trays were examined after routine cleaning and sterilization in a blinded study. These reprocessed instruments originated from five National Health Service hospital trust sterile service departments in England and Wales. Determination of residual protein and peptide contamination was carried out by acid stripping of the instrument surfaces, hydrolysis of the constituent amino acids and quantitative total amino acid analysis. One hundred and twenty instruments were analysed, and the median levels of residual protein contamination per instrument for the individual trays were 267, 260, 163, 456 and 756 microg. Scanning electron microscopy and energy dispersive X-ray spectroscopic analyses of the instruments showed that tissue deposits were localized on surfaces, but there was no significant correlation between overall protein soiling and instrument complexity. The highest levels of residual contamination were found on instruments used for tonsillectomy and adenoid surgery.

It has now been established that transmissible spongiform encephalopathy (TSE) infectivity, which is highly resistant to conventional methods of deactivation, can be transmitted iatrogenically by contaminated stainless steel. It is important that new methods are evaluated for effective removal of protein residues from surgical instruments. Here, radio-frequency (RF) gas-plasma treatment was investigated as a method of removing both the protein debris and TSE infectivity. Stainless-steel spheres contaminated with the 263K strain of scrapie and a variety of used surgical instruments, which had been cleaned by a hospital sterile-services department, were examined both before and after treatment by RF gas plasma, using scanning electron microscopy and energy-dispersive X-ray spectroscopic analysis. Transmission of scrapie from the contaminated spheres was examined in hamsters by the peripheral route of infection. RF gas-plasma treatment effectively removed residual organic residues on reprocessed surgical instruments and gross contamination both from orthopaedic blades and from the experimentally contaminated spheres. In vivo testing showed that RF gas-plasma treatment of scrapie-infected spheres eliminated transmission of infectivity. The infectivity of the TSE agent adsorbed on metal spheres could be removed effectively by gas-plasma cleaning with argon/oxygen mixtures. This treatment can effectively remove 'stubborn' residual contamination on surgical instruments.

AIM: The aims of this study were to evaluate the extracolonic findings identified in patients undergoing minimal preparation abdomino-pelvic CT in place of barium enema or colonoscopy for the detection of possible colorectal carcinoma. MATERIALS AND METHODS: The CT technique involved helical acquisition (10 mm collimation, 1.5 pitch) following 2 days of preparation with oral contrast medium only. Extracolonic findings were evaluated in the light of subsequent follow-up and accuracy. The evaluation included assessment of the potential contribution of the extracolonic finding(s) to staging the cancer in the subset of patients who had colorectal carcinoma, and to account for the patients' presenting symptoms and signs in the remaining patients. RESULTS: A total of 344 extracolonic findings were detected in 261 CT examinations, from amongst a total of 1077 cases (24%). Extracolonic findings were potentially important in staging in 32 of the 98 (33%) cases subsequently found to have colorectal cancer. There were 284 extracolonic findings amongst the 221 cases who proved not have colorectal cancer. One hundred and twenty-four (44%) of these 284 findings were actively followed up by clinicians, and 33 (12%) ultimately had a surgical intervention. Fifty-six percent (160/284) of the findings were determined to be correct (by further investigation, autopsy, and/or clinical follow-up); the remainder were incorrect or indeterminate (n = 56) or had no follow-up (n = 68). The commonest extracolonic findings were focal liver lesions (found in 42/1077, 4%) and abdominal aortic aneurysms (31/1077, 3%). Twenty-four (24/1077, 2%) previously unknown extracolonic malignancies were detected. Ten percent (106/1077) of the patients had extracolonic findings that could potentially have accounted for their presenting symptoms. CONCLUSIONS: CT has the added benefit, compared with colonoscopy and barium enema, of not just evaluating the colon but also of detecting extracolonic abnormalities. Such findings may be useful in staging the cancer, may explain the patient's presenting symptoms, and may detect other potentially serious disorders.

The theoretical risk of prion transmission via surgical instruments is of current public and professional concern. These concerns are further heightened by reports of the strong surface affinity of the prion protein, and that the removal of organic material by conventional sterilization is often inadequate. Recent reports of contamination on sterilized endodontic files are of particular relevance given the close contact that these instruments may make with peripheral nerve tissue. In this paper, we report the effective use of a commercial gas plasma etcher in the cleaning of endodontic files. A representative sample of cleaned, sterilized, files was screened, using scanning electron microscopy and energy-dispersive X-ray analysis, to determine the level of contamination before plasma cleaning. The files were then exposed for a short-term to a low-pressure oxygen-argon plasma, before being re-examined. In all cases, the amount of organic material (in particular that which may have comprised protein) was reduced to a level below the detection limit of the instrument. This work suggests that plasma cleaning offers a safe and effective method for decontamination of dental instruments, thus reducing the risk of iatrogenic transmission of disease during dental procedures. Furthermore, whilst this study focuses on dental files, the findings indicate that the method may be readily extended to the decontamination of general surgical instruments.

As a prelude to photodynamic therapy, 5-aminolevulinic acid (ALA) was given orally to healthy dogs. ALA-induced protoporphyrin IX (PpIX) fluorescence significantly increased in the mucosa of the urinary bladder in an ALA dose-dependent fashion. Vomiting occurred after ALA administration in 70% of the dogs but did not affect PpIX fluorescence. ALA-based photodynamic therapy (PDT) of the urinary bladder in healthy dogs caused only submucosal oedema within the bladder wall. No haematologic or serum biochemistry abnormalities were observed after ALA administration. Microscopic haematuria was observed in all the dogs after PDT but was mild and self limiting. ALA-based PDT was administered to six dogs with transitional cell carcinoma (TCC) of the lower urinary tract. ALA-based PDT resulted in tumour progression-free intervals from 4 to 34 weeks in five dogs; one dog with pre-existing hydronephrosis died shortly after PDT. Dogs with TCC represent an outbred, spontaneous, tumour model for developing PDT protocols for humans with bladder cancer.

Frail and physically or mentally disabled patients frequently have difficulty in tolerating formal colonic investigations. The aims of this study were to evaluate the accuracy of minimal-preparation CT in identifying colorectal carcinoma in this population and to determine the clinical indications and radiological signs with the highest yield for tumour. The CT technique involved helical acquisition (10-mm collimation, 1.5 pitch) following 2 days of preparation with oral contrast medium only. The outcome of 4 years of experience was retrospectively reviewed. The gold standards were pathological and cancer registration records, together with colonoscopy and barium enema when undertaken, with a minimum of 15 months follow-up. One thousand seventy-seven CT studies in 1031 patients (median age 80 years) were evaluated. CT correctly identified 83 of the 98 colorectal carcinomas in this group but missed 15 cases; sensitivity and specificity (with 95% confidence interval) 85% (78-92%) and 91% (90-93%), respectively. Multivariate analysis identified: (a) a palpable abdominal mass and anaemia to be the strongest clinical indications, particularly in combination (p<0.0025); and (b) lesion width and blurring of the serosal margin of lesions to be associated with tumours (p<0.0001). Computed tomography has a valuable role in the investigation of frail and otherwise disabled patients with symptoms suspicious for a colonic neoplasm. Although interpretation can be difficult, the technique is able to exclude malignancy with good accuracy.

The biodistribution and pharmacokinetics of meta-tetra(hydroxyphenyl)chlorin (mTHPC)(1) have been documented in humans, rats, dogs and rabbits. It has been demonstrated to be an effective photodynamic therapy agent for treatment of squamous cell carcinoma. Squamous cell carcinoma is a common feline neoplasm, causing significant morbidity and mortality in the feline population. The association between ultraviolet radiation exposure and occurrence of this neoplasm in the cat provides a useful model for the study of human cutaneous squamous cell carcinoma. In this study, we document the biodistribution, pharmacokinetics and toxicity of mTHPC in a group of normal cats. Four groups of cats were given the drug intravenously at dosages of 0, 0.15, 0.30 and 0.60 mg/kg. mTHPC levels were measured in plasma and tissues at 0, 24, 48, 72, 96 and 336 h after drug administration. Additionally, plasma samples were collected at 1 and 6 h post-injection and analysed. Biodistribution and pharmacokinetics of mTHPC in cats mirrors that in other animal species. There were no clinical or pathological changes associated with administration of the drug. The biodistribution and pharmacokinetics of mTHPC in cats mirrors that in other species studied. There were no clinical or pathological changes attributable to administration of the drug at the doses administered. mTHPC may be a useful photodynamic therapy drug in cats.

Hydrogen peroxide (H(2)O(2)), an oxidant present in high concentrations in the aqueous humor of the elderly eyes, is known to impart toxicity to the lens---apoptosis being one of the toxic events. Since H(2)O(2) causes lipid peroxidation leading to the formation of reactive end-products, it is important to investigate whether the end-products of lipid peroxidation are involved in the oxidation-induced apoptosis in the lens. 4-Hydroxynonenal (HNE), a major cytotoxic end product of lipid peroxidation, has been shown to mediate oxidative stress-induced cell death in many cell types. It has been shown that HNE is cataractogenic in micromolar concentrations in vitro, however, the underlying mechanism is not yet clearly understood. In the present study we have demonstrated that H(2)O(2) and the lipid derived aldehydes, HNE and 4-hydroxyhexenal (HHE), can induce dose- and time-dependent loss of cell viability and a simultaneous increase in apoptosis involving activation of caspases such as caspase-1, -2, -3, and -8 in the cultured human lens epithelial cells. Interestingly, we observed that Z-VAD, a broad range inhibitor of caspases, conferred protection against H(2)O(2)- and HNE-induced apoptosis, suggesting the involvement of caspases in this apoptotic system. Using the cationic dye JC-1, early apoptotic changes were assessed following 5 h of HNE and H(2)O(2) insult. Though HNE exposure resulted in approximately 50% cells to undergo early apoptotic changes, no such changes were observed in H(2)O(2) treated cells during this period. Furthermore, apoptosis, as determined by quantifying the DNA fragmentation, was apparent at a much earlier time period by HNE as opposed to H(2)O(2). Taken together, the results demonstrate the apoptotic potential of the lipid peroxidation end-products and suggest that H(2)O(2)-induced apoptosis may be mediated by these end-products in the lens epithelium.

OBJECTIVE: To compare clinical outcome, healing, and effect of tracheostomy in conventional incisional and carbon dioxide (CO2) laser techniques for resection of soft palates in brachycephalic dogs. DESIGN: Prospective randomized trial. ANIMALS: 20 adult brachycephalic dogs. METHODS: Dogs were randomly allocated into 4 groups, and 1 of the following was performed: palate resection by use of a CO2 laser; incisional palate resection and closure with suture; and palate resection by use of a C02 laser or incision with tracheostomy. A clinical score for respiratory function was assigned to each dog at 0, 2, 8, 16, and 24 hours. Biopsy specimens of incision sites obtained at days 0, 3, 7, and 14 were examined. Data were analyzed to determine the effects of technique on clinical and histologic outcome. RESULTS: Mean surgical time for laser (309 seconds) was significantly shorter than for sharp dissection (744 seconds). Surgical technique significantly affected clinical scores at 3 of the 5 postoperative time points, but differences were not clinically apparent. Tracheostomy significantly affected clinical scores at 3 of 5 postoperative time points. After tracheostomy tube removal, clinical scores were similar to those of dogs without tracheostomies. Inflammation, necrosis, and ulceration were evident in all groups at day 3; these lesions had almost resolved by day 14. Most complications were associated with tracheostomy. CONCLUSIONS AND CLINICAL RELEVANCE: Clinical outcomes appear to be similar with the laser and incisional techniques. Regarding surgical time and ease, laser resection of the soft palate appears advantageous. Tracheostomy is not warranted in dogs that have uncomplicated surgeries and recoveries.

An aged beef cow was presented for signs of thoracic disease. A complete clinical and diagnostic workup suggested neoplasia. Postmortem examination revealed a lymphoma of T-cell lineage confined solely to the thoracic cavity, predominantly in lung tissue. The diagnosis was based on light and electron microscopy, immunohistochemistry, and negative bovine leukemia virus and bovine immunodeficiency virus results.

A 4.5-year-old llama was admitted for evaluation of a firm mass rostral and ventral to the medial canthus of the left eye. Mucopurulent nasal discharge and absence of airflow through the left nostril were noted. Radiographs of the skull revealed a sharply demarcated soft tissue mass with faint mineralization. Endoscopy of the nasal passages revealed a mucosa-covered mass originating in the area of the second premolar, extending to the edge of the soft palate, and obstructing the airway. Examination of the oral cavity revealed a missing second molar and a mass protruding 2-cm from the empty alveolus. An ossifying fibroma, a previously unreported tumor in llamas, was diagnosed at postmortem examination.

Muscle biopsy homogenates contain GLUT-3 mRNA and protein. Before these studies, it was unclear where GLUT-3 was located in muscle tissue. In situ hybridization using a midmolecule probe demonstrated GLUT-3 within all muscle fibers. Fluorescent-tagged antibody reacting with affinity-purified antibody directed at the carboxy-terminus demonstrated GLUT-3 protein in all fibers. Slow-twitch muscle fibers, identified by NADH-tetrazolium reductase staining, possessed more GLUT-3 protein than fast-twitch fibers. Electron microscopy using affinity-purified primary antibody and gold particle-tagged second antibody showed that the majority of GLUT-3 was in association with triads and transverse tubules inside the fiber. Strong GLUT-3 signals were seen in association with the few nerves that traversed muscle sections. Electron microscopic evaluation of human peripheral nerve demonstrated GLUT-3 within the axon, with many of the particles related to mitochondria. GLUT-3 protein was found in myelin but not in Schwann cells. GLUT-1 protein was not present in nerve cells, axons, myelin, or Schwann cells but was seen at the surface of the peripheral nerve in the perineurium. These studies demonstrated that GLUT-3 mRNA and protein are expressed throughout normal human skeletal muscle, but the protein is predominantly found in the triads of slow-twitch muscle fibers.

A 32-year-old black woman presented with progressive proptosis, diplopia, and optic disc edema of the right eye. A computed tomography scan of the orbit showed a right retroorbital mass. A gallium scan showed increased radiotracer activity in the right retroorbital region. Biopsy of the mass showed non-caseating granulomas that were compatible with sarcoidosis. The patient was treated with systemic steroids, and the proptosis and diplopia resolved. Seven months later, the patient presented with contralateral optic neuropathy. Neuroimaging showed enlargement of the left optic nerve. The patient again responded to systemic steroid treatment and experienced complete restoration of vision. An orbital apex lesion may be the presenting manifestation of sarcoidosis.

BACKGROUND: Canavan disease (CD) is an autosomal recessive leukodystrophy characterized by deficiency of aspartoacylase (ASPA) and increased levels of N-acetylaspartic acid (NAA) in brain and body fluids, severe mental retardation and early death. Gene therapy has been attempted in a number of children with CD. The lack of an animal model has been a limiting factor in developing vectors for the treatment of CD. This paper reports the successful creation of a knock-out mouse for Canavan disease that can be used for gene transfer. METHODS: Genomic library lambda knock-out shuttle (lambdaKOS) was screened and a specific pKOS/Aspa clone was isolated and used to create a plasmid with 10 base pair (bp) deletion of exon four of the murine aspa. Following linearization, the plasmid was electroporated to ES cells. Correctly targeted ES clones were identified following positive and negative selection and confirmed by Southern analysis. Chimeras were generated by injection of ES cells to blastocysts. Germ line transmission was achieved by the birth of heterozygous mice as confirmed by Southern analysis. RESULTS: Heterozygous mice born following these experiments have no overt phenotype. The homozygous mice display neurological impairment, macrocephaly, generalized white matter disease, deficient ASPA activity and high levels of NAA in urine. Magnetic resonance imaging (MRI) and spectroscopy (MRS) of the brain of the homozygous mice show white matter changes characteristic of Canavan disease and elevated NAA levels. CONCLUSION: The newly created ASPA deficient mouse establishes an important animal model of Canavan disease. This model should be useful for developing gene transfer vectors to treat Canavan disease. Vectors for the central nervous system (CNS) and modulation of NAA levels in the brain should further add to the understanding of the pathophysiology of Canavan disease. Data generated from this animal model will be useful for developing strategies for gene therapy in other neurodegenerative diseases.

OBJECT: This study offers clinical support for the concept that neurosurgical interruption of a midline posterior column pathway by performing a punctate midline myelotomy (PMM) provides significant pain relief without causing adverse neurological sequelae in cancer patients with visceral pain refractory to other therapies. METHODS: A PMM of the posterior columns was performed in six cancer patients in whom visceral pain had been refractory to other therapies. The cause of the visceral pain was related to residual, progressive, or recurrent local cancer or postirradiation effects. Clinical efficacy of the procedure was examined by comparing patient pain ratings and narcotic usage pre- and post-PMM. Follow-up periods ranged from 3 to 31 months. Examination of the results indicates a significant reduction in pain ratings as well as a significant reduction in daily narcotic use. No adverse neurological effects were observed. One spinal cord has been recovered for postmortem examination. CONCLUSIONS: These findings provide corroborating clinical evidence for the existence of a newly recognized midline posterior column pathway that mediates the perception of visceral pelvic and abdominal pain. Preliminary data indicate that significant pain relief can be obtained following PMM with minimal neurological morbidity and suggest that the procedure may provide an alternative treatment modality for cancer-related pain in patients in whom adequate pain control with narcotics cannot be achieved or narcotic side effects cannot be tolerated.

Henoch-Schönlein purpura (HSP) is usually a mild condition involving the skin, gut, joints, and kidneys and has a good prognosis. We present a 63-year-old Hispanic man who had an unusually severe form of HSP with a fatal outcome attributable to vasculitis causing myocardial necrosis. There is only one citation in the literature of HSP-related myocardial vasculitis, which involved the right ventricle and was successfully treated with steroids. Our patient had severe HSP-related myocardial necrosis, tracheobronchitis, and nephritis. The bronchial lesions resolved, presumably because of steroid therapy. This probably is the first case of fatal myocardial necrosis related to HSP. We conclude that HSP can, in some cases, have an aggressive course. It becomes imperative to recognize the involvement of the other organ systems, such as the heart, so that appropriate therapy may be initiated. Immunosuppression may have a beneficial effect on extrarenal lesions. Controlled clinical trials are needed to establish the efficacy of such treatment.

A 12-year-old, neutered female, Siberian Husky dog presented with a hind limb weakness of one month duration. To facilitate making a diagnosis multiple imaging modalities were performed. These modalities included radiography, ultrasonography, magnetic resonance imaging (MRI), magnetic resonance angiography (MRA) and selective angiography of the abdominal aorta. In this dog, the MRI/MRA studies provided the first documentation of the external iliac thrombi and the collateral circulation via the lumbar arteries. At necropsy, an aortoiliac thrombus caused by a mineralized arteriosclerotic plaque was noted.

1,3,5-Trinitrobenzene (TNB) is a soil and water contaminant at certain military installations. Encephalopathy in rats given 10 daily oral doses of TNB has been reported. The lesion was bilaterally symmetric vacuolation and microcavitation in the cerebellar roof nuclei, vestibular nuclei, olivary nuclei, and inferior colliculi. The contribution of the blood-brain barrier (BBB) in the genesis of these lesions remains uncertain. One of the main goals of the present work was to evaluate the functional state of the BBB. Male Fischer 344 rats (five rats/group) were euthanatized after four, five, six, seven, eight, or 10 daily doses of TNB (71 mg/kg). A different set of rats (five rats/group) was allowed to recover for 10 or 30 days after receiving 10 doses of TNB. Integrity of the BBB was assessed by immunohistochemical staining for extravasated plasma albumin on paraffin-embedded sections. Rats euthanatized after four to eight doses had no lesions, and albumin extravasation in the susceptible regions of the brain was minimal. Rats receiving 10 daily doses of TNB had bilaterally symmetric vacuolation and microcavitation in the cerebellar nuclei, vestibular nuclei, and inferior colliculi in association with multifocal, often confluent foci of extravasated albumin in susceptible nuclei. Albumin was present in vascular walls, extracellular space, and neurons. Immunoreactivity in neurons was of two types: cytoplasmic staining representing pinocytic uptake and homogeneous staining of the entire neuron (nucleus and cytoplasm) due to uncontrolled albumin leakage through the damaged cell membrane. In rats allowed to recover for 10 days, the microcavitated foci were infiltrated by glial and gitter cells. Albumin immunoreactivity was present as extracellular granular debris, and neuronal staining (for albumin) was mild. In rats allowed to recover for 30 days, immunoreactivity to albumin was not seen. This study demonstrates that TNB-mediated tissue damage is accompanied by breakdown of the BBB. The presence of vacuolation and associated extravasated serum proteins in TNB-treated rats is an indication of vasogenic brain edema, which appears to be a critical event in TNB toxicity. Additional studies are needed to determine the reason for selective regional vulnerability and brain microvascular susceptibility to TNB.
